Controls on the system and
remote control
1 STANDBY ON
to switch the system on or to standby
mode.
to use for EASY SET.
2 PROGRAM
for CD ............ to program CD tracks.
for TUNER ..... to program preset radio
stations.
for CLOCK ..... to select 12- or 24-
hour in clock setting
mode.
3 DIGITAL SOUND CONTROL
DISPLAY PANEL
to view the desired DSC display.
4 JOG CONTROL/DSC
to select the desired equalizer display:
OPTIMAL, JAZZ, ROCK or TECHNO.
5 DBB (DYNAMIC BASS BOOST)
to switch on bass boost to enhance
bass response or to switch off bass
boost.
6 DISPLAY SCREEN
to view the current setting of the
system.
7 CD CAROUSEL TRAY
8 DISC CHANGE
to change CD(s).
9 OPEN•CLOSE
to open or close the CD carousel tray.
0 DISC 1 / DISC 2 / DISC 3 (CD
DIRECT PLAY)
to select a CD tray for playback.

! SOURCE – to select the following:
CD / (CD 1•2•3)
to select CD mode. When CD playback
is stopped, press to select disc tray 1,
2 or 3.
TUNER / (BAND)
to select Tuner mode. When in tuner
mode, press to select the waveband:
FM or MW.
TAPE / (TAPE 1• 2)
to select Tape mode.
AUX / (VIDEO)
to select sound from an external
source (e.g. TV, VCR, Laser Disc player,
DVD player or CD Recorder).
@ MODE SELECTION
SEARCH à á (TUNING à á)
for CD ............ to search backward/
forward.
for TUNER ...... to tune to a lower or
higher radio frequency.
for CLOCK ..... to set the hour (on the
system only) .
STOP•CLEAR Ç
for CD ............ to stop CD playback or
to clear a program.
for TUNER ..... to stop programming.
for DEMO ...... (on the system only) to
start or stop
demonstration mode.
PLAY É / PAUSE Å
for CD ............ to start or interrupt
playback.
PREV í / NEXT ë(PRESET 43 )
for CD ............ to skip to the beginning
of the current, previous,
or next track.
for TUNER ..... to select a preset
station in memory.
for CLOCK ..... to set the minute (on
the system only).
# VOLUME
to increase or decrease the volume.
$ n
to connect headphones.
% DIM
to select different brightness for the
display screen : DIM 1, DIM 2, DIM 3
or DIM OFF.
^ CLOCK•TIMER
to view the clock, set the clock or set
the timer.
& TAPE DECK 2
* TAPE DECK 2 OPERATION
PLAYÉ ....... to start playback.
à ................. to rewind the tape.
á ................. to fast forward the
tape.
STOP•OPEN...to stop playback or to
open the tape door.
PAUSE ......... to interrupt playback.
( TAPE DECK 1 OPERATION
RECORD ....... to start recording.
PLAYÉ ....... to start playback.
à ................. to rewind the tape.
á ................. to fast forward the
tape.

CONTROLS
STOP•OPEN...to stop playback/
recording or to open the
tape door.
PAUSE ......... to interrupt playback or
recording.
) TAPE DECK 1
¡ MIC LEVEL (not available for version
/30)
to adjust the mixing level for karaoke
or microphone recording.
™ MICROPHONE (not available for
version /30)
to connect microphones jack.
£ REPEAT
to repeat a CD track, a disc, or all
available discs.
≤ MUTE
to switch off the sound temporarily.
∞ SHUFFLE
to play all the available discs and their
tracks in random order.
§ SLEEP
to switch the system to standby mode
at a selected time.
≥ B
to switch the system to standby mode.
Notes for remote control:
– First select the source you wish to
control by pressing one of the
source select keys on the remote
control (e.g. CD ,TUNER, etc.).
– Then select the desired function
( É , í , ë , etc.).
